Experience the awe-inspiring Great Migration, one of the Seven Natural Wonders of the World. Every year, millions of wildebeest, zebras, and gazelles traverse the Maasai Mara in search of greener pastures, braving predators and river crossings in a spectacle like no other.
Maasai Mara is home to the Big Five: lions, leopards, elephants, rhinos, and buffaloes. In addition, cheetahs, giraffes, and hippos thrive in this iconic savannah, offering unforgettable wildlife encounters for nature enthusiasts.
Explore the traditions and lifestyle of the Maasai people, who call this region home. Their vibrant culture, traditional dances, and colorful beadwork add a unique human touch to the breathtaking natural landscape of Maasai Mara.
Maasai Mara National Park is a wildlife destination in southwestern Kenya that is named after the Maasai people and the Mara River that runs through it. The park is famous for its stunning landscapes, abundant wildlife, and the annual wildebeest migration. Visitors can enjoy a variety of activities such as game drives, hot air balloon safaris, nature walks, and cultural visits to Maasai villages. The park offers a unique opportunity to witness the incredible diversity of Africa's wildlife and immerse oneself in the traditional culture of the Maasai people.
